Honey Goat Cheese and Fig Crostini<\/h2>\n

Honey Goat Cheese and Fig Crostini
\nElevate your appetizer game with this sweet and savory combination of honey goat cheese, caramelized figs, and crispy crostini. Perfect for a quick snack or as part of a larger spread.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/strong>
\n– 1 baguette, sliced into 1\/4-inch thick rounds
\n– 8 oz goat cheese, crumbled
\n– 2 tbsp pure honey
\n– 1 cup fresh figs, stemmed and chopped
\n– 1 tsp olive oil
\n– Salt and pepper to taste<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/strong><\/p>\n

1. Preheat oven to 400\u00b0F (200\u00b0C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
\n2. Arrange baguette slices on the prepared baking sheet.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le with salt. Bake for 5-7 minutes, or until lightly toasted.
\n3. In a small bowl, mix crumbled goat cheese with honey until well combined.
\n4. Top each crostini with a spoonful of the goat cheese mixture, followed by a few pieces of chopped figs.
\n5. Serve immediately and enjoy!<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 10-12 minutes (including baking time)<\/p>\n

Roasted Beet Salad with Honey Goat Cheese<\/h2>\n

Roasted Beet Salad with Honey Goat Cheese
\nRoasted Beet Salad with Honey Goat Cheese<\/p>\n

A sweet and earthy twist on the classic beet salad, this recipe combines roasted beets with creamy honey goat cheese and a sprinkle of fresh herbs.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/p>\n

– 2 large beets
\n– 1\/4 cup olive oil
\n– 2 tbsp balsamic vinegar
\n– 1\/4 cup honey
\n– 8 oz goat cheese, crumbled
\n– 1\/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
\n– Salt and pepper to taste<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/p>\n

1. Preheat oven to 425\u00b0F (220\u00b0C).
\n2. Wrap beets in foil and roast for 45-50 minutes, or until tender.
\n3. Let beets cool, then peel and slice into wedges.
\n4. In a small bowl, whisk together olive oil and balsamic vinegar.
\n5. Toss roasted beets with the dressing and season with salt and pepper.
\n6. Crumbling goat cheese over the beets, then drizzle with honey.
\n7. Sprinkle parsley over the top and serve.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 55-60 minutes<\/p>\n

Honey Goat Cheese Stuffed Dates<\/h2>\n

Honey Goat Cheese Stuffed Dates
\nElevate your appetizer game with this simple yet impressive recipe that combines the natural sweetness of dates, the creaminess of goat cheese, and a hint of honey. Perfect for parties or gatherings, these bite-sized treats are sure to please!<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/strong><\/p>\n

– 12 pitted Medjool dates
\n– 1\/2 cup crumbled goat cheese (ch\u00e8vre)
\n– 2 tbsp pure honey
\n– Fresh thyme leaves (optional)<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/strong><\/p>\n

1. Preheat your oven to 375\u00b0F (190\u00b0C).
\n2. Cut a slit down the center of each date, being careful not to cut all the way through.
\n3. Fill each date with about 1-2 tsp of goat cheese.
\n4. Drizzle honey over the goat cheese.
\n5. If desired, add a sprig of fresh thyme on top.
\n6. Place the stuffed dates on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
\n7. Bake for 10-12 minutes or until the cheese is melted and the dates are soft.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 10-12 minutes<\/p>\n

Serve warm and enjoy!<\/strong><\/p>\n

Warm Honey Goat Cheese Dip with Herbs<\/h2>\n

Warm Honey Goat Cheese Dip with Herbs
\nWarm Honey Goat Cheese Dip with Herbs: A Simple yet Sophisticated Snack<\/p>\n

This warm and creamy dip is perfect for any gathering, whether it’s a cozy night in or a lively party. The combination of tangy goat cheese, sweet honey, and fragrant herbs will have your guests begging for more.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/p>\n

– 8 oz goat cheese, crumbled
\n– 2 tbsp honey
\n– 1\/4 cup chopped fresh herbs (such as parsley, chives, or dill)
\n– 1\/2 tsp lemon zest
\n– Salt and pepper to taste<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/p>\n

1. Preheat your oven to 350\u00b0F (180\u00b0C).
\n2. In a medium bowl, combine the crumbled goat cheese, honey, chopped herbs, and lemon zest.
\n3. Mix until smooth and creamy, adding salt and pepper as needed.
\n4. Transfer the mixture to a small baking dish or ramekin.
\n5.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the dip is warm and slightly puffed.
\n6. Serve warm with crackers, vegetables, or bread.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 10-12 minutes<\/p>\n

Grilled Peach and Honey Goat Cheese Salad<\/h2>\n

Grilled Peach and Honey Goat Cheese Salad
\nGrilled Peach and Honey Goat Cheese Salad Recipe<\/p>\n

This refreshing summer salad combines the sweetness of grilled peaches with the tanginess of honey goat cheese, all on a bed of crisp greens. Perfect for warm weather gatherings or a light lunch.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/p>\n

– 4 ripe peaches, sliced
\n– 1\/2 cup honey goat cheese, crumbled
\n– 2 tablespoons olive oil
\n– 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
\n– Salt and pepper to taste
\n– 4 cups mixed greens (arugula, spinach, etc.)
\n– Fresh thyme leaves for garnish<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/p>\n

1. Preheat grill or grill pan to medium-high heat.
\n2. Brush peach slices with olive oil and season with salt and pepper.
\n3. Grill peaches for 2-3 minutes per side, until caramelized and tender.
\n4. In a large bowl, combine mixed greens, crumbled goat cheese, and grilled peaches.
\n5. Drizzle with balsamic vinegar and toss to combine.
\n6. Garnish with fresh thyme leaves and serve immediately.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 10-12 minutes<\/p>\n

Honey Goat Cheese and Caramelized Onion Pizza<\/h2>\n

Honey Goat Cheese and Caramelized Onion Pizza
\nTransform your pizza game with this sweet and savory combination of honey, goat cheese, and caramelized onions.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/strong><\/p>\n

– 1 lb pizza dough (homemade or store-bought)
\n– 2 tbsp olive oil
\n– 1 large onion, thinly sliced
\n– 1 tsp salt
\n– 1\/4 cup honey
\n– 8 oz goat cheese, crumbled
\n– Fresh thyme leaves for garnish<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/strong><\/p>\n

1. Preheat the oven to 425\u00b0F (220\u00b0C).
\n2. Roll out the pizza dough to your desired thickness and place it on a baking sheet.
\n3. Drizzle the olive oil over the dough, leaving a small border around the edges.
\n4. Caramelize the onions by cooking them in a pan with salt over medium heat for 30-40 minutes, stirring occasionally.
\n5. Spread the caramelized onions evenly over the pizza dough.
\n6. Crumble the goat cheese over the onions and drizzle with honey.
\n7. Bake for 15-20 minutes or until crust is golden brown.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 20-25 minutes<\/p>\n

Honey Goat Cheese Stuffed Chicken Breast<\/h2>\n

Honey Goat Cheese Stuffed Chicken Breast
\nElevate your dinner game with this sweet and savory recipe that combines the richness of goat cheese with the tenderness of chicken breast. This dish is perfect for a special occasion or a cozy night in.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/strong><\/p>\n

– 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
\n– 1\/2 cup goat cheese, crumbled
\n– 2 tbsp honey
\n– 1 tsp dried thyme
\n– Salt and pepper, to taste<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/strong><\/p>\n

1. Preheat oven to 375\u00b0F (190\u00b0C).
\n2. In a small bowl, mix together goat cheese, honey, and thyme.
\n3. Lay chicken breasts flat and make a horizontal incision in each breast to create a pocket.
\n4. Stuff each breast with the goat cheese mixture, dividing it evenly among the four breasts.
\n5. Season the outside of the chicken with salt and pepper.
\n6. Place the stuffed chicken breasts on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
\n7. Bake for 25-30 minutes or until cooked through.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 25-30 minutes<\/p>\n

Honey Goat Cheese and Balsamic Glazed Brussels Sprouts<\/h2>\n

Honey Goat Cheese and Balsamic Glazed Brussels Sprouts
\nElevate your side dish game with this sweet and tangy recipe that combines the richness of goat cheese with the sweetness of honey and the depth of balsamic glaze. Perfect for a special occasion or a cozy dinner.<\/p>\n

Ingredients:<\/strong><\/p>\n

– 1 pound Brussels sprouts, trimmed
\n– 2 tablespoons olive oil
\n– 1\/4 cup honey
\n– 1\/4 cup crumbled goat cheese (ch\u00e8vre)
\n– 2 tablespoons balsamic glaze
\n– Salt and pepper to taste
\n– Fresh thyme leaves for garnish (optional)<\/p>\n

Instructions:<\/strong><\/p>\n

1. Preheat oven to 400\u00b0F (200\u00b0C).
\n2. Toss Brussels sprouts with olive oil, salt, and pepper on a baking sheet. Roast for 20-25 minutes or until tender.
\n3. In a small saucepan, combine honey and balsamic glaze. Bring to a simmer over medium heat. Cook for 5-7 minutes or until the glaze thickens slightly.
\n4. Remove Brussels sprouts from oven. Drizzle with the honey-balsamic glaze and sprinkle with crumbled goat cheese. Toss to combine.
\n5. Serve warm, garnished with fresh thyme leaves if desired.<\/p>\n

Cooking Time:<\/strong> 30-35 minutes<\/p>\n
